Мир детских игр претерпевает революционные изменения благодаря стремительному развитию технологий дополненной реальности (AR)․ Дети‚ привыкшие к интерактивному контенту‚ все чаще ожидают от игр не просто захватывающих сюжетов‚ но и полного погружения в виртуальный мир‚ который гармонично переплетается с реальностью․ Создать такие игры – непростая задача‚ требующая освоения специфических инструментов и технологий․ В этой статье мы рассмотрим основные из них‚ помогая вам понять‚ как воплотить в жизнь ваши идеи и создать увлекательные AR-игры для юных пользователей․
Выбор платформы и среды разработки
Первый шаг в создании AR-игры для детей – выбор подходящей платформы․ Наиболее популярными вариантами являются iOS и Android‚ которые обеспечивают доступ к миллионам потенциальных игроков․ Выбор зависит от вашей целевой аудитории и бюджета․ Разработка под iOS часто требует большего начального вложения‚ но обеспечивает более высокое качество графики и производительность․ Android предоставляет более широкую аудиторию‚ но может потребовать больше усилий при оптимизации игры под различные устройства․
Следующим важным решением является выбор среды разработки․ Для создания AR-приложений используются различные инструменты‚ от мощных игровых движков до специализированных SDK (Software Development Kits)․ Среди популярных вариантов можно выделить Unity и Unreal Engine‚ которые предлагают широкий набор функций и инструментов для создания высококачественной графики и интерактивности․ Они также обладают обширными сообществами разработчиков‚ где можно найти поддержку и готовые решения․
Популярные SDK для дополненной реальности
Кроме игровых движков‚ существуют специализированные SDK‚ которые упрощают работу с AR-технологиями․ Например‚ ARKit от Apple и ARCore от Google предоставляют готовые функции для распознавания объектов‚ отслеживания движения и отображения виртуальных объектов в реальном мире․ Эти SDK значительно упрощают процесс разработки и позволяют сосредоточиться на игровой логике и дизайне․
- ARKit (iOS)⁚ Предоставляет инструменты для создания высококачественных AR-приложений на устройствах Apple․
- ARCore (Android)⁚ Аналогичный инструмент для Android-устройств‚ обеспечивающий кросс-платформенную совместимость․
- Vuforia Engine⁚ Популярный кросс-платформенный SDK с расширенными возможностями распознавания изображений и объектов․
Дизайн и геймдизайн для детей
Создание увлекательной AR-игры для детей требует особого подхода к дизайну и геймдизайну․ Необходимо учитывать возрастные особенности целевой аудитории‚ учитывая их когнитивные способности и интересы․ Интерфейс должен быть интуитивно понятным и простым в использовании‚ с яркой и привлекательной графикой․ Игровой процесс должен быть достаточно простым‚ чтобы дети могли быстро освоить его‚ но при этом достаточно сложным‚ чтобы удерживать их интерес․
Важно избегать сложных механик и элементов управления‚ предпочитая простые и интуитивные действия․ Использование анимации‚ звуковых эффектов и ярких цветов поможет привлечь внимание детей и сделать игру более увлекательной․ Не забывайте о безопасности⁚ игру необходимо тестировать на детях‚ чтобы убедиться‚ что она не содержит ничего‚ что могло бы им навредить․
Важные аспекты дизайна для детских AR-игр
Аспект | Рекомендации |
---|---|
Графика | Яркие‚ красочные изображения‚ простые формы‚ милые персонажи․ |
Звуковое сопровождение | Привлекательные мелодии‚ веселые звуковые эффекты‚ понятная озвучка․ |
Управление | Простые и интуитивные жесты‚ минимальное количество кнопок․ |
Сюжет | Понятный и интересный сюжет‚ ориентированный на возрастную группу․ |
Тестирование и публикация
После завершения разработки необходимо тщательно протестировать игру на различных устройствах и с различными возрастными группами․ Это поможет выявить и исправить ошибки‚ улучшить юзабилити и убедиться‚ что игра соответствует ожиданиям целевой аудитории․ Тестирование должно включать в себя проверку производительности‚ удобства использования и общей привлекательности игры․
После успешного тестирования можно приступать к публикации игры в соответствующих магазинах приложений – App Store и Google Play․ При подготовке к публикации необходимо тщательно заполнить все необходимые поля‚ включая описание игры‚ скриншоты и видеоролики․ Это поможет привлечь внимание потенциальных игроков и увеличить количество загрузок․
Создание детских AR-игр – увлекательный и перспективный процесс‚ требующий знаний в области программирования‚ геймдизайна и работы с AR-технологиями․ Выбор правильных инструментов и технологий‚ а также учет возрастных особенностей целевой аудитории – ключ к успеху․ Надеюсь‚ эта статья помогла вам получить общее представление о процессе создания таких игр․
Хотите узнать больше о разработке игр? Прочитайте наши другие статьи о разработке мобильных игр и использовании искусственного интеллекта в играх!
Облако тегов
Дополненная реальность | Детские игры | ARKit | ARCore | Unity |
Unreal Engine | Vuforia | Разработка игр | Мобильные игры | SDK |